Davide Elmo is a researcher in Rock Engineering, specializing in advancing rock mechanics, engineering design, and cutting-edge numerical modeling. Elmo's work emphasizes a pioneering approach that integrates human factors into technical decision-making. His research focuses on critical areas such as discrete fracture network engineering, surface-underground mining interactions, hard-rock pillar analysis, and slope stability analysis. A registered Professional Engineer in British Columbia, Elmo has authored or co-authored over 180 papers published in leading international journals and conference proceedings. Notably, he is advancing the field of 'Behavioural Rock Engineering,' which studies how cognitive biases influence engineering design decisions. His interdisciplinary approach addresses essential questions regarding uncertainty, knowledge transfer, and the ethical implications of automated decision-making within high-stakes environments.
